How Viral Social Media Trends Are Reshaping Restaurant Menus and Food Economics
Viral social media recipes are moving from smartphone screens to restaurant menus as food industry executives capitalize on unexpected culinary trends.
By Foodie Pundit Newsroom - Published - Updated - Section: Social Virality

Key points
- Social media platforms now act as primary incubators for mass-market food trends and consumer flavor preferences.
- Supply chains and food distributors are utilizing digital monitoring tools to predict sudden inventory spikes driven by viral content.
- Restaurant operators are rapidly adapting menus to incorporate high-demand internet recipes to capture younger demographics.
- Agile consumer packaged goods companies are shortening product development cycles to commercialize digital food fads.
